Description WCG is the largest company within the W2O Group, an independent network of marketing, research and communications firms. WCG provides its clients with fully integrated communications, creative and interactive services, to deliver messages to customers - wherever they are. WCG also draws on the resources and expertise across the W2O Group of firms to provide its clients with analytics and insights that they can’t get anywhere else. Established by Jim Weiss in 2001, WCG continues to grow with offices in Austin, LA, London New York, San Francisco and Minneapolis.
